A pair of Florida teens has been charged in the drag-racing death of one of their young passengers, according to reports. Austin Lewis, 17, and Kristopher Trenker, 19, began racing each other at speeds of up to 120 mph July 24, Tampa police said. Payton Fordyce, 16, was in the backseat of Lewis’ vehicle when Lewis suddenly swerved to avoid an oncoming car and smashed into a cement culvert.
